Motor/Horsepower

Treadmills are powered by electrical motors that produce the energy needed to move your treadmill's belt and drive you along. Most manufacturers will mention the energy as "horsepower", or more specifically continuous duty horsepower (CHP).

You might notice that the more powerful the CHP number the more expensive the treadmill. This is due to a variety of factors, such as the amount of work that goes into making the motor and components that allow the treadmill to function.

It's not the best use of your fitness equipment budget to choose a treadmill based solely on its motor's power. Just as it would be delusional to buy a truck with a high towing capacity if you only need to haul a couple of boxes, purchasing a treadmill with a higher-than-necessary motor power is often a waste of money.

If you plan to use your treadmill for short jogs or walks or for HIIT workouts such as HIIT, a treadmill with 2.5 CHP could be enough. If you want to run a marathon, you'll want to go with a stronger option that has a continuous-duty rating of at least 3.5 CHP.

The majority of commercial treadmills use AC motors because they tend to run cooler and last longer. They are also more reliable and are better suitable for commercial use which is where treadmills are in use throughout the day.

AC motors also have a built in cooling fan which eliminates the need for a separate cooling device. They are therefore more eco friendly than DC Motors, which need an additional cooling system in order to disperse heat. The only drawback of AC motors is that they take longer than DC motors to warm up. In most instances, you can avoid this problem by purchasing an surge protector and keeping your treadmill connected when not in use.

Warranty

When you are shopping for treadmills, ensure you check the warranty offered by each company. The warranties on treadmills are usually divided into three categories: frame, motor, and parts/electronics. A good frame warranty will be around 10 years.

The motor drives the treadmill belt and is a major component of the treadmill's cost. A cheap treadmill will usually have an inefficient motor which will burn out more quickly. A good warranty for the motor should be at least 10 years, and some models will even provide a lifetime warranty.
